Understanding the Factors Affecting Restoration Costs
Several key elements determine the overall expense of water damage restoration. The source of the water is a primary factor; for instance, clean water from a burst pipe typically requires less intensive remediation than water contaminated by sewage or floodwaters. The extent and duration of the water intrusion are also significant. The longer water sits, the deeper it penetrates materials like drywall, flooring, and subflooring, necessitating more extensive drying and potential material replacement. The types of materials affected also play a role; porous materials like carpet and drywall absorb water more readily and may need to be removed and replaced, whereas non-porous materials might be salvageable with thorough drying. Accessibility to affected areas can also impact labor costs, as difficult-to-reach spaces may require more time and specialized equipment to address. Finally, the need for specialized equipment, such as industrial strength structural drying units, or the involvement of reconstruction services following the drying process, will directly influence the final bill.
The Water Damage Restoration Process
When faced with water damage in your Saddle River home, a systematic approach is essential for effective remediation. The process typically begins with an initial assessment to determine the scope of the damage, identify the water source, and categorize the water type (clean, gray, or black water). Following this, immediate steps are taken to stop the water flow and remove standing water using pumps and extraction equipment. This is followed by the crucial phase of structural drying. Here, advanced drying systems, including dehumidifiers and air movers, are deployed to extract moisture from the air and building materials. This stage is vital to prevent mold growth and secondary damage. Technicians carefully monitor humidity and moisture levels to ensure materials return to their appropriate dryness. Once drying is complete, affected materials are assessed. Damaged structural components and finishes may need to be repaired or replaced, encompassing services like drywall repair, flooring installation, and repainting. Throughout the entire process, thorough documentation is maintained, including moisture readings and work performed, which is important for insurance purposes.
Assessing the Quality of Water Damage Restoration Work
After the restoration process, it’s important to evaluate the completed work to ensure your home has been properly remediated. A key indicator of quality is the absence of lingering moisture. You should not detect any musty odors, which often signify ongoing mold growth due to inadequate drying. Visually inspect repaired or replaced materials for seamless integration and a consistent appearance with the surrounding unaffected areas. Pay attention to the performance of any affected systems, such as plumbing or electrical, to ensure they are functioning correctly. If reconstruction was involved, check that all work meets building code standards and the original aesthetic of your home. A reputable provider will have conducted thorough drying, addressed all affected materials, and performed necessary repairs to a high standard, returning your property to a safe and habitable condition.
